I am in need of Java library for graphs that supports dynamic visualization. I need to have objects moving between the vertices and this has to be shown. 3D is not needed, a 2D representation will suffice.

I am currently using JUNG but it is very limited, it is more for static graphs from what I can tell.

I have looked at this question but JGraphT doesn’t seem to do it either.


Late Edit:

I waited to finish the project before awarding an answer. I ended up keeping JUNG, while also using UBIGraph (dead project since 2012) as a secondary library.

    Take a look:

    • GEF – GUI components for graphical editing, including graphs, (Eclipse) SWT based
    • JGraphX – former JGraph, not actively developed since March 2020
    • Piccolo2D – (Eclipse) SWT based
    • JUNG – last released in 2010 (as of 2020); was very popular back then
    • yWorks – not open source, not free
    • JGraphT – data handling and algorithms only, no integrated visualizaiton, though supports JGraphX visualization
